However, in defence of the Buchanan Society, which is the oldest (founded in 1725) clan society around, as a private organisation, they were well within their rights to admit and deny whomever they choose as members. It should also be pointed out that they were started as a charitable relief society, so obviously they would want to verify the legitimacy of potential members who might receive their aid.
